Honor of Kings expands in India with two slots for KWC 2026. Discover dates for the KINGS’ Arise City Tour in Bengaluru, Mumbai, and Delhi.

The Indian esports scene is excited as Honor of Kings makes its official announcement of expansion into India. In a bid to place India firmly on the world map, Honor of Kings has reserved two dedicated slots for Indian teams to compete at KWC at EWC26.

This is a huge opportunity for Indian gamers. KWC (Honor of Kings Invitational Championship) is the highest level of global tournaments for Honor of Kings, and having guaranteed spots means Indian gamers will compete against the world’s best in a global arena.

Two Indian Slots in KWC at EWC 2026

The allocation of two dedicated slots for India in KWC at EWC 2026 is a game-changer. In a way, by securing two dedicated slots for India, the players are not just observers in the world of esports.

This is a way of ensuring that the best of India’s players have a direct route to compete at the highest level of international competition and prove that India is a priority in the world of esports.

The KINGS’ Arise: India City Tour for Boosting India HOK Esports

To find the best talent and reach out to fans, Honor of Kings is launching the KINGS’ Arise: India City Tour. This is a tournament series where the action comes directly to fans in the form of offline finals.

So, if you are a fan of competitive gaming, here are the dates you should keep marked:

  • Bengaluru: 22 March 2026
  • Mumbai: 29 March 2026
  • Delhi: 5 April 2026

All city finals will begin at 12:30 PM IST and have a prize pool of INR 100,000. It is not just about winning; it is about laying a strong foundation for competitive gaming in India.

Honor of Kings Esports Boost in India

Beyond that level, there are plans for the long term. The Honor of Kings Campus Series (KCS) is also in the pipeline to be rolled out across the nation. This is a competition for collegiate games, providing university students a chance to get into esports and rise up through the ranks.
